Channel Assignments

The channel ON/OFF assignments for the NXC-VAI4 are described in the following table.
Off = 50% voltage, and all channel assignments are mutually exclusive.

NXC-VAI4 Channel Assignments

Channel

State

Function

Channel 1

ON

While channel 1 is ON, the voltage on Output 1 will ramp up at the "CURRENT
OUTPUT 1 RAMP UP TIME" rate. The voltage ramp stops if the maximum is reached.

OFF

Stops voltage ramping on Output 1 at current value.

Channel 2

ON

While channel 2 is ON, the voltage on Output 2 will ramp up at the "CURRENT
OUTPUT 2 RAMP UP TIME" rate. The voltage ramp stops if the maximum is reached.

OFF

Stops voltage ramping on Output 2 at current value.

Channel 3

ON

While channel 3 is ON, the voltage on Output 3 will ramp up at the "CURRENT
OUTPUT 3 RAMP UP TIME" rate. The voltage ramp stops if the maximum is reached.

OFF

Stops voltage ramping on Output 3 at current value.

Channel 4

ON

While channel 4 is ON, the voltage on Output 4 will ramp up at the "CURRENT
OUTPUT 4 RAMP UP TIME" rate. The voltage ramp stops if the maximum is reached.

OFF

Stops voltage ramping on Output 4 at current value.

Channel 5

ON

While channel 5 is ON, the voltage on Output 1 will ramp down at the "CURRENT
OUTPUT 1 RAMP DOWN TIME" rate. The voltage ramp stops if the minimum is
reached.

OFF

Stops voltage ramping on Output 1 at current value.

Channel 6

ON

While channel 6 is ON, the voltage on Output 2 will ramp down at the "CURRENT
OUTPUT 2 RAMP DOWN TIME" rate. The voltage ramp stops if the minimum is
reached.

OFF

Stops voltage ramping on Output 2 at current value.

Channel 7

ON

While channel 7 is ON, the voltage on Output 3 will ramp down at the "CURRENT
OUTPUT 3 RAMP DOWN TIME" rate. The voltage ramp stops if the minimum is
reached.

OFF

Stops voltage ramping on Output 3 at current value.

Channel 8

ON

While channel 8 is ON, the voltage on Output 4 will ramp down at the "CURRENT
OUTPUT 4 RAMP DOWN TIME" rate. The voltage ramp stops if the minimum is
reached.

OFF

Stops voltage ramping on Output 4 at current value.

Channel 9

ON

Reserved [do not use]

OFF

Reserved [do not use]

Channel 10 ON

While channel 10 is ON, the voltage on Output 1 is set to 100%

OFF

Sets Output 1 voltage to 50%.

Channel 11

ON

While channel 11 is ON, the voltage on Output 2 is set to 100%

OFF

Sets Output 2 voltage to 50%.

Channel 12 ON

While channel 12 is ON, the voltage on Output 3 is set to 100%

OFF

Sets Output 3 voltage to 50%.

Channel 13 ON

While channel 13 is ON, the voltage on Output 4 is set to 100%

OFF

Sets Output 4 voltage to 50%.

Channel 14 ON

While channel 14 is ON, the voltage on Output 1 is set to 0%

OFF

Sets Output 1 voltage to 50%.

Channel 15 ON

While channel 15 is ON, the voltage on Output 2 is set to 0%

OFF

Sets Output 2 voltage to 50%.

Channel 16 ON

While channel 16 is ON, the voltage on Output 3 is set to 0%

OFF

Sets Output 3 voltage to 50%.
